Job Overview
JOB FUNCTION
- Contribute to the development/modification of business processes and contribute to the implementation, installation & setup of systems for settlements. Confirm, verify, reconcile OPGl’s daily payment amounts for transactions conducted in the Interconnected & Ontario wholesale and retail markets. Verify data and payments and liaise with counter party contacts.
- Confirm, verify and reconcile with counterparts and ensure that payments to be received/forwarded are accurate and reflect services/products provided/purchased by OPGI. Monitor contracts and agreements and ensure that terms/conditions are properly reflected in internal billing systems. Advise Management on the appropriateness of initiating formal dispute resolution process with counter parties for any discrepancies that cannot be informally rectified to OPGl’s satisfaction.
- Provide on-going strategic guidance to OPGI staff and Front Office staff of Energy Markets in particular. Make qualitative and comparative assessments of the Business’s performance w.r.t. interconnected & Ontario markets performance. Coordinate documentation for submission to internal and external bodies. Liaise and work through an established network of internal and external contacts to secure, protect and advance the interests of OPGI.
Keep abreast of current developments in the electricity market and utility industry trends.. Make qualitative and comparative assessments of the Business’s performance. Coordinate documentation for submission of information to internal and external contacts. - JOB DUTIES
- Take a lead role in development of business processes for the settlement function as it will exist in a competitive electricity marketplace (within Ontario and Interconnected markets). On an on-going basis, review the effectiveness of existing settlement processes and initiate changes to these processes as rules/conditions change and/or warrant.
- Provide expert advice on settlement processes in the competitive electricity market.
- Review established business processes used within OPGI, the IMO, and other markets to ensure compliance of actual activities.
- Stay current on Ontario and other jurisdiction Market Rules evolution and revise Settlement processes as necessary. Contribute to formulation of other processes, as market rules evolve.
- Provide on-going reconciliation and verification expertise for OPG Energy Markets revenue streams.
- Ensure all invoices are forwarded to Accounts payable and Accounts Receivable and that funds are transferred.
- Suggest to Management on appropriateness for initiating more formal dispute resolution processes with IMO, LDC or other counter parties. where conflicts exist and cannot be rectified through informal reconciliation processes.
- Keep track of disputes, monitor progress on their resolution, provide updates on status (including assessment of benefits associated with the disputes).
- Make bilateral contract amount declarations to the IMO per terms of contracts with bilateral customers and within the timelines outlined in the Market Rules.
- Ensure the quality and accuracy of transactions and settlement statements.
- Ensure completeness and consistency of transaction database.
- Make qualitative and comparative assessments of OPG Energy Markets performance. Track its performance on an on going basis and advise on possible changes to bidding/operations as appropriate.
- Contribute documentation for submission to internal and external agencies (e.g. Electricity Production, IMO, OEB). Support the process to prepare senior staff in the presentation of testimony as required.
- Liaise and work through an established network of internal and external contacts to secure, protect and advance the interests of OPGI.
